We are seeking a Data Analyst to develop and ensure the integrity and quality of our organization’s data assets. The ideal candidate will have strong SQL skills, analytical, creative, and innovative approach to solving problems, and excellent written and verbal communication skills.
Requirements
- Develop ETL processes to integrate company databases and external data sources.
- Design and develop stored procedures, views and functions using T-SQL.
- Create reports and data visualizations in Tableau
- Conduct data quality assessments and develop strategies to identify and mitigate data integrity issues.
- Responds to Data Reporting Help Desk requests.
- Ensure the quality of the data that is available to end users
- Identify and lead operational improvement opportunities
- Contribute to the development of tools and processes which make the team more efficient
- Collaborate with teams that support us (IT, HIT, Quality)
- Develops and maintains effective relationships with staff at all levels throughout the agency.
- Completes all required documentation, in timelines in accordance with program standards.
